Output e5e11d046a9df76cfd73d460c7ee6c35f13bc18e932859b488744bd13167fd43:24

value
706186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4163fb0bd56cffeb1e8e238744f2f2af819faa03 OP_EQUAL
address
37emcnmvAMBeDUBdPdycjTN6SnnmSjuAGk
transaction
e5e11d046a9df76cfd73d460c7ee6c35f13bc18e932859b488744bd13167fd43
confirmations
186871
spent
true